Description
Sticky Honey Gochujang Chicken is a delectable dish that perfectly balances sweet and spicy flavors, making it an instant favorite for any gathering. This recipe features tender chicken thighs coated in a sticky, aromatic marinade of honey and gochujang, creating an unforgettable culinary experience. Whether grilled or baked, this dish is sure to impress with its vibrant colors and irresistible taste. Serve it with rice or noodles for a satisfying meal that’s perfect for busy weeknights or casual get-togethers.
Ingredients
- 1 ½ lbs boneless, skinless chicken thighs
- ½ cup raw honey
- ¼ cup gochujang (Korean chili paste)
- 4 cloves garlic, minced
- 2 tbsp soy sauce (low sodium)
- 1 tbsp toasted sesame oil
- 2 green onions, sliced (for garnish)
- 1 tbsp toasted sesame seeds (for garnish)
Instructions
- In a bowl, mix honey, gochujang, minced garlic, soy sauce, and sesame oil. Add chicken thighs and coat well. Cover and refrigerate for at least 30 minutes.
- Set your oven to 400°F (200°C) or preheat your grill to medium-high.
- Transfer marinated chicken to a lined baking sheet or grill. Bake for 25-30 minutes or grill until the internal temperature reaches 165°F (74°C), basting with leftover marinade halfway through.
- Let the chicken rest for 5 minutes before garnishing with sliced green onions and sesame seeds.
- Plate alongside rice or noodles and drizzle remaining glaze over the top.
